New Robin Williams Documentary ‘When The Laughter Stops’ Examines John Belushi’s Death in the ’80s

Double Heart Ache –

AUGUST 9, 2019 – At the time, a concerned Robin asked John, who was down on the floor at the famous hotel, if he was okay. The comedian assured him he was fine and Robin left. Not long after, John overdosed on heroin and cocaine at age 33. “It was probably a horrible burden. It would be very difficult I think to move on and also to be such close friends,” Heather McDonald said.
